Ultra-Processed Foods: A Key Driver of Modern Health Problems

A growing body of evidence shows that ultra-processed foods are displacing traditional, whole-food diets worldwide and driving major diet-related chronic diseases. Drawing on decades of dietary surveys, global sales data, cohort studies, randomized trials, and mechanistic research, this first paper in a three-part Lancet Series reports that ultra-processed foods have rapidly replaced long-established eating patterns; that this shift worsens diet quality through overeating, nutrient imbalance, loss of protective compounds, and increased exposure to harmful additives; and that it raises the risk of a wide range of chronic diseases affecting nearly every organ system. Together, more than 100 prospective and interventional studies support the conclusion that this dietary shift is a key contributor to the global rise in chronic illness, with companion papers outlining policy and public health strategies to restore diets based on fresh and minimally processed foods.
